Alcohol and Drug Counselor Exam Terms In This Set (191) Culture-bound syndrome - illness truly bound to specific culture; refer to otherwise common mental or physical illnesses that are subsequently construed as unusual because of pathoplastic influence of clture (e.g, hallucinatory sx of schizophrenia could be due to demon possession) pharmacological therapy and psychotherapy - two key mental health treatment paradigms of Western medicine (multimodal therapy) racism and discrimination - refer to attitudes, beliefs, and practices that prejudge and denigrate individuals or gs based on disparate phenotypic characteristics (skin color, hair texture, facial features, etc) or ethnic minority group affiliation What is the trend for cultural diversity in the US? - increasing rapidly and steadily; by 2025, 40% adults (48% children) will be from ethnic and racial minority gps. HIV - the viral agent that causes AIDS (Acquired Immunodeficiency Syndrome), which is the final stage in the HIV disease process; most prevalent in men having sex with men and IV drug users; contributes to poverty, homelessness, an other medical problems 50% - percent increase in the number of seniors needing substance abuse treatment. 70% rate of increase in treatment Limits to confidentiality - 1. Client request for release of information 2. Court orders for release of information 3. Danger to self 4. Danger to others 5. Suspected Child abuse/neglect cause by a client 6. Grave disability CAGE questionnaire - Have you ever felt you should CUT DOWN on your drinking? Have people ANNOYED you by criticizing your drinking? Have you ever felt bad or GUILTY about your drinking? Have you ever had a drink first thing in the morning to steady your nerves (EYE-OPENER)? - 4-question on alcohol abuse MAST - Michigan Alcoholism Screening Test - yes or no to 25 questions to explore number of treatment issues; most accurate and oldest screening tool to identify drinkers with 98% accuracy What is another cultural issues beyond the client's culture? - counselor's culture Relapse-remitting model of addiction - recognizes that some issues tend to return cyclically overtime, can help counselor and CLT make advance contingency plans to avoid having brief relapse in negative circumstances or behaviors Authentically connected referral network - refers to a carefully established set of services providers prepared to meet client needs; goal is for all network agencies an providers to recognize their valued and essential roles in the addiction treatment process and for clients to recognize this and respond with similar trust and confidence. What is the primary aim of case management services, beyond providing seamless care and being client-centered? - to provide least restrictive level of care Ask-teLl-ask technique - asking permission of the client to talk with them, telling them of any concerns you have, and then asking for their thoughts on what you shared. Referral form - used to track the results of the referral; WHO (identifies the client and counselor involved/demographic info; substance use, legal issues, family concerns) WHAT (issues that generated the need for the referral, substance/work, family, and goals and commitments) HOW (address how CLT was engaged and dealt with) When should planning for aftercare be engaged - at the point of initial counselor-client contact What should be the focus of treatment mostly? - positive education and skills in substance abuse triggers, patterns of use, and relapse prevention; substance issues, recovery, health issues, co-occurring disorders; holistic treatment planning an interventions are essential in recovery process Bookend term in substance abuse treatment means.. - discussing a trigger event with someone trusted before and after it occurs Trigger events - often crisis stressors or situations CFR 42, part 2 - confidentiality in areas of alcohol and substance abuse. confidentiality restriction apply: 1) to records, w/c may not be disclosed even in admin, civil, criminal, or legislative proceedings by any govt authority
